[packages/dokuwiki/DEVEL] use system jquery, current 1.8, not 1.9 version
glen
glen at pld-linux.org
Wed May 29 17:40:26 CEST 2013
commit d6cd357a907931ef999ce48dcf180d3b23683c97
Author: Elan Ruusamäe <glen at delfi.ee>
Date: Tue May 28 21:28:09 2013 +0300
use system jquery, current 1.8, not 1.9 version
dokuwiki.spec | 23 ++++++++++++++---------
system-jquery.patch | 13 ++++++++-----
2 files changed, 22 insertions(+), 14 deletions(-)
---
diff --git a/dokuwiki.spec b/dokuwiki.spec
index 187e725..691f456 100644
--- a/dokuwiki.spec
+++ b/dokuwiki.spec
@@ -8,7 +8,7 @@ Summary: PHP-based Wiki webapplication
Summary(pl.UTF-8): Aplikacja WWW Wiki oparta na PHP
Name: dokuwiki
Version: %{ver}
-Release: 0.5
+Release: 0.8
License: GPL v2
Group: Applications/WWW
Source0: http://www.splitbrain.org/_media/projects/dokuwiki/%{name}-%{subver}.tgz
@@ -52,9 +52,12 @@ URL: https://www.dokuwiki.org/
BuildRequires: fslint
BuildRequires: rpm-php-pearprov >= 4.4.2-11
BuildRequires: rpmbuild(macros) >= 1.520
-#Requires: jquery >= 1.9
+Requires: jquery >= 1.8
+#Requires: jquery >= 1.9.1
Requires: jquery-cookie
-Requires: jquery-ui
+#Requires: jquery-migrate
+#Requires: jquery-ui >= 1.10.2
+Requires: jquery-ui >= 1.8
Requires: php(core) >= %{php_min_version}
Requires: php(session)
Requires: php(xml)
@@ -158,7 +161,7 @@ mv conf/users.auth.php{.dist,}
mv conf/mysql.conf.php{.example,}
find -name _dummy | xargs rm
-%{__rm} lib/index.html lib/plugins/index.html lib/images/index.html inc/lang/.htaccess
+%{__rm} lib/index.html lib/plugins/index.html lib/images/index.html inc/lang/.htaccess conf/.htaccess
# we just don't package deleted files, these get removed automatically on rpm upgrades
%{__rm} data/deleted.files
@@ -182,12 +185,14 @@ rm -rf lib/plugins/config/_test
# use system packages
%{__rm} lib/scripts/jquery/update.sh
-#%{__rm} lib/scripts/jquery/jquery-ui.js
-#%{__rm} lib/scripts/jquery/jquery-ui.min.js
+%{__rm} lib/scripts/jquery/jquery-ui.js
+%{__rm} lib/scripts/jquery/jquery-ui.min.js
%{__rm} lib/scripts/jquery/jquery.cookie.js
-#%{__rm} lib/scripts/jquery/jquery.js
-#%{__rm} lib/scripts/jquery/jquery.min.js
-#%{__rm} -r lib/scripts/jquery/jquery-ui-theme
+%{__rm} lib/scripts/jquery/jquery.js
+%{__rm} lib/scripts/jquery/jquery.min.js
+%{__rm} lib/scripts/jquery/jquery-migrate.js
+%{__rm} lib/scripts/jquery/jquery-migrate.min.js
+%{__rm} -r lib/scripts/jquery/jquery-ui-theme
# cleanup backups after patching
find '(' -name '*~' -o -name '*.orig' ')' -print0 | xargs -0 -r -l512 rm -f
diff --git a/system-jquery.patch b/system-jquery.patch
index 6b9a094..4cf4f10 100644
--- a/system-jquery.patch
+++ b/system-jquery.patch
@@ -1,13 +1,16 @@
---- dokuwiki-2013-03-05/lib/exe/js.php~ 2013-03-03 21:16:43.000000000 +0200
-+++ dokuwiki-2013-03-05/lib/exe/js.php 2013-03-05 12:40:14.025436522 +0200
-@@ -41,8 +41,8 @@
+--- dokuwiki-2013-05-10/lib/exe/js.php 2013-05-28 11:51:39.656021911 +0300
++++ dokuwiki-2013-05-10/lib/exe/js.php 2013-05-28 16:22:44.737594377 +0300
+@@ -40,10 +40,9 @@
+
// array of core files
$files = array(
- DOKU_INC."lib/scripts/jquery/jquery$min.js",
+- DOKU_INC."lib/scripts/jquery/jquery$min.js",
- DOKU_INC.'lib/scripts/jquery/jquery.cookie.js',
- DOKU_INC."lib/scripts/jquery/jquery-ui$min.js",
+- DOKU_INC."lib/scripts/jquery/jquery-migrate$min.js",
++ "/usr/share/jquery/jquery$min.js",
+ '/usr/share/jquery/cookie/cookie.js',
+ '/usr/share/jquery/ui/jquery-ui.js',
- DOKU_INC."lib/scripts/jquery/jquery-migrate$min.js",
DOKU_INC."lib/scripts/fileuploader.js",
DOKU_INC."lib/scripts/fileuploaderextended.js",
+ DOKU_INC.'lib/scripts/helpers.js',
================================================================
---- gitweb:
http://git.pld-linux.org/gitweb.cgi/packages/dokuwiki.git/commitdiff/79d978d61fd563dad4233d5f2cb789ebfdd78b73
More information about the pld-cvs-commit
mailing list